Mrs. Aul was born in Portland and moved to the Muncie area as a child. She owned and operated the Celebration Center for several years before retiring. She also had worked for AFTCO Corp. She was a member of St. Mary's Caholic Church, Jolly Homemakers Club and a life member and four-term president of the Soroptimist Club.
She was preceded in death by a sister.
Services will be at 10 a.m. Tuesday in St. Mary's Catholic Church. Burial will be in Elm Ridge Cemetery. Calling will be 3-8 p.m. Monday at Meeks Mortuary with a scripture service at 8 p.m., and an hour before services Tuesday at St. Mary's Catholic Church.
